Plinko has a surprisingly long history for a game that looks so simple. The concept traces back to the classic American game show where contestants dropped a disc down a pegged board to win prizes. Online casinos picked up the format in the early 2010s, and it quickly became one of the most-played games globally — not because it's complicated, but precisely because it isn't. phbingo.ph brought Plinko to the Philippine market with a version tuned specifically for local players.

The risk level system is one of the most thoughtful design choices in phbingo.ph's Plinko implementation. Rather than offering a single fixed payout table, the game lets you choose how volatile you want your session to be. Low risk on 8 rows is almost meditative — the ball rarely strays far from center, wins are frequent, and the session feels sustainable. High risk on 16 rows is the opposite: most drops land near the center for small returns, but when the ball finds an edge slot, the 1000× multiplier is genuinely life-changing on a meaningful bet size. The ability to switch between these modes mid-session gives phbingo.ph's Plinko a depth that keeps players engaged far longer than a single-mode game would.
